Erdogan: Turkey maintains contacts with Ukraine and Russia to revive Istanbul process

Turkey maintains contacts with Ukraine and Russia to intensify the Istanbul negotiation process and is ready to contribute to establishing a just and lasting peace.

This was discussed during a telephone conversation between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dogan and French President Emmanuel Macron, Ukrinform reports, citing a statement from the Turkish leader's office on social media X.

“Turkey is making every effort to end the war between Ukraine and Russia by establishing a just and lasting peace... Contacts with the parties are continuing to revitalize the Istanbul process, and Turkey is ready to do everything possible to open the door to peace as soon as possible,” the statement said.

During the conversation, Erdogan stressed that diplomatic channels should be used as effectively as possible to achieve lasting peace.

According to him, Turkey will continue its efforts towards a ceasefire, avoiding steps that threaten global peace, and will contribute to peace efforts.

During the conversation, the parties also discussed bilateral Turkish-French relations and the situation in the Caucasus, Gaza, and Syria.

As reported by Ukrinform, on Monday, December 1,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y was on a visit to France. At a joint press conference, Macron said that there is currently no “complete peace plan,” but only a number of issues for which various parties are responsible for making decisions.
